CL 3.1 Living in community

June 12, 2017

The unit of work demonstrates one approach that can be taken with Year 3 students and the Christian Living key idea: Christians believe that God creates people to live in relationship with him and with each other.

Students investigate the uniqueness associated with the creation of human beings, feeling loved and valued, friendship and neighbourliness, conflict in relationships after which they explore and analyse the accounts in the Bible of Jesus’ interactions with people. From there they apply their findings to ways of living in family and school community.
